    Abstract: An invertible ink stamp comprises an ink absorber/retainer member disposed on top of the ink pad, an absorbent member disposed on the top of the ink absorber/retainer member and having capillary attraction weaker than that of the ink absorber/retainer member but sufficient to absorb excessive ink, the absorbent member having a vent in at least part of the top side or either of lateral sides for conducting to the atmospheric air, an ink tank having an ink supply tube that has its distal open end connected to the ink absorber/retainer member, and a wall member surrounding the whole circumferential surface of the ink absorber/retainer member for avoiding leakage of ink.

    Abstract: A torsion beam type suspension is provided which includes a U-shaped stabilizer consisting of a stabilizer main body and a pair of laterally opposite stabilizer arms. The stabilizer main body is disposed in front of and along a torsion beam and rotatably supported on the torsion beam by means of brackets. The arms of the stabilizer are disposed along the inboard sides of the trailing arms and have axial ends connected to lower ends of connecting rods, respectively. The connecting rods are disposed so that the axes thereof extend vertically and connected at upper ends thereof to a vehicle body side member.

    Abstract: A wheel revolution detecting device comprises a sensor rotor fixed to a wheel and coaxial with a rotation axis thereof and having circumferetially continuous irregularities on a peripheral surface thereof, and a pickup sensor fixed to a vehicle body and including a detecting part disposed near the irregularities of the sensor rotor, the detecting part having an end face inclined with respect to a longitudinal axis thereof.
